The best way to pray the Rosary

extracted from the most well-known book in the matter: "The secret of the Rosary"

Of all the ways of saying the holy Rosary, the most glorious to God, most salutary to our souls, and the most terrible to the devil is that of saying or chanting the Rosary publicly in two choirs. 
God is very pleased to have people gathered together in prayer. All the angels and the blessed unite to praise him unceasingly.
- St Louis Marie de Montfort
This way of praying is of the greatest benefit to us because:
1. Mind Motivation
Our minds are usually more alert during public prayer than when we pray alone.


4. Indulgences
Every time you say the Rosary in
common, you gain a hundred days indulgence.
[Ad perpetuam rei memoriam, of the year 1626 by Urban VIII]

2. Strengthtened as Group
When we pray in common, the prayer of each one belongs to the whole group and make all together but one prayer, so that if one person is not praying well, someone else in the same gathering who is praying better makes up for his deficiency.
  • Those who are strong uphold the weak.
  • Those who are fervent inspire the lukewarm
  • The rich enrich the poor
  • The bad are merged with the good.

3. Gain Bigger Merits
One who says his Rosary alone only gains the merit of one Rosary; but if he says it with thirty other people, he gains the merit of thirty Rosaries.
This is the law of public prayer.
How profitable, how advantageous this is! 
5. Advocate on disasters and distress
Public prayer is more powerful than private prayer to appease the anger of God and call down his mercy, and the Church, guided by the Holy Spirit, has always advocated it in times of disasters and general distress.
